Introduction Autism Spectrum Disorder (ASD) affects how individuals communicate, behave, and interact with the world around them. Every child on the autism spectrum is unique, with different strengths and challenges. Navigating these differences requires a structured, evidence-based approach, and this is where Applied Behavior Analysis (ABA) Therapy plays a transformative role. ABA Therapy is widely recognized as one of the most effective treatments for children with autism. It focuses on improving specific behaviors, such as communication, social skills, academic performance, and daily living tasks.
